Inside Life Eku Edewor & Liz Yemoja in Elizabeth Waldorf. Who Wore It Better? TSB News Apr 20, 2014 1 Eku Edewor Liz Yemoja. Who wore it better? Photo Credit: Bella Naija Read More
Inside Life Why Nigerian Companies Struggle to Retain Top Talent (and How to Fix It) TSB News Nov 7, 2025
Inside Life UNILAG Is Teaming Up With The University of Birmingham for a New Campus TSB News Nov 7, 2025